Responsibilities A key role with the largest Jones Act employer with a diverse fleet of vessels. We're actively hiring a Chief Engineer, for our Ship Assist operation in the PNW. To include duties in watch standing; making engine room and vessel repairs; conduct preventative maintenance inspections; cleaning and associated paperwork. Maintain engine room inventory (parts, tools, & supplies). Responsible for all filter and strainer changes; fuel and lube loading and transfer. Must intake and stow supplies. In addition, general deck duties including line handling and any other duties deemed necessary by the tug master. Must follow all Safety Directives and Vessel Security Procedures as well as CMS policies, guidelines, and directives. Must follow all applicable regulatory agency rules and regulations. This position does require the candiate to join the Inlandboatmen's Union as part of their onboarding after accepting a job offer. All employees have the opportunity to join the Mariner Employee Resource Group; which is focused on creating a safe, inclusive, and diverse workforce. Qualifications Minimum Qualifications: DDE license Any Horsepower or higher OICEW, VPDSD Valid STCW with all required endorsements (including but not limited to CPR/First Aid, Advanced Firefighting) TWIC Valid passport -must be able to travel internationally with no felonies, DUI or other convictions which would restrict entry into Canada or other nations. Preferred Caterpillar and Voith experience Minimum Experience Experience as an Engineer aboard towing vessel Knowledge of current electronically controlled engines and control system Experience and ability to troubleshoot and make repairs to ships operating systems such as main engine, propulsion, generator, hydraulics, pumps, and electrical. Basic skill level operating a PC Computer Rotation: 2 weeks on 2 weeks off Compensation: As per IBU Contract or Administrative Conditions. Approx. $697.68/day Geographic Area: Puget Sound - Port Pier 17, Seattle, WA
